WebNov 15, 2024 · After obtaining an avocado seed, follow these instructions for growing avocados indoors: To sprout an avocado seed, insert three toothpicks into it and suspend it with the broad end down over a glass of water. Cover about an inch of the seed with water. Care for it in a warm place, but not in direct sunlight. WebApr 10, 2024 · Indoor avocado trees need bright, direct sunlight for at least six hours a day, and they prefer temperatures between 60°F to 85°F (15°C to 29°C). They also need well-draining soil with good aeration and regular fertilization. Maintaining the right level of humidity can also be a challenge, as avocado trees prefer a humid environment.
